What is Unit Cost?

 , updated on December 25, 2016
Unit cost is the expenditure required to produce, distribute and sell one unit of a product or service including both overhead such as advertising and variable costs such as material and labor.
It is common to measure unit cost at the margin, meaning the cost to produce one additional unit. In many cases, unit costs drop as a company benefits from economies of scale but eventually increase as new facilities such as factories are required to produce additional units.
